Course Overview

Theoretical Physics addresses the meaning of everything by employing the language of mathematics to understand the universe. From quantum information and grand unified theories of particle physics, to dark matter and cosmology, this subject can take you anywhere.

Our three-year BSc Theoretical Physics degree will teach you how fundamental physics and mathematical techniques are applied to understand advances in quantum information, cosmology, semiconductors, lasers, nuclear & particle physics.

You will explore the big questions, such as how did the universe begin, what are space and time made of and is it possible to recreate in a laboratory the conditions that existed seconds after the big bang?

You will have the opportunity to work on advanced projects, under the supervision of internationally recognised theoretical physicists in Swansea.

Physics at Swansea University is a widely admired degree that attracts students from across the world.

Your learning will be shaped by the large theoretical physics (PPCT) group with inspirational academics such as Professors Carlos Nunez and Tim Hollowood, internationally renowned for their research contributions to string theory, quantum field theory and black hole physics.

The Particle Physics & Cosmology Theory group in Swansea is one of the largest in the UK, with 12 academic staff engaged in research in a wide range of topics in Theoretical Physics.

Theoretical Physics Employment Opportunities

Our Swansea Physics graduates have excelled in a wide range of careers, including roles as research physicists, data scientists, AI and software engineers, demand forecasters, patent examiners, and quantitative finance analysts. Our alumni network illustrates their involvement across many sectors, such as government research, aerospace, defence, energy, nuclear, engineering, the private sector, education, and space exploration. We take pride in the strong connections they maintain with the department and are delighted to showcase their career advancements to our current students.

A significant percentage of our graduates go on to pursue a postgraduate degree and/or research with a wide variety of specialisations.

Entry Requirements

A levels: grades A*AB-ABB including A in Maths.

Advanced Skills Baccalaureate Wales: Requirements are as for A-Levels where you can substitute the same non-subject specific grade for the Advanced Skills Baccalaureate Wales' Level Core Grade.

BTEC: Refer to Admissions.

Scottish Highers: ABBBC to include A in Mathematics and Physics. 

Access to Science: Refer to admissions

International Baccalaureate: 32 overall with 5 in Higher Level Maths and Physics

IELTS 6.0 (with a minimum of 5.5 in each component) or equivalent English test.

All applications will be considered on an individual basis, and we will look at the whole application when deciding whether to make an offer of a place, including: the balance, nature and quality of A-level, AS and GCSE subjects (or equivalent); personal statement and referee’s comments.

How You're Taught

We are proud to provide an outstanding educational experience, using the most effective learning and teaching approaches, carefully tailored to suit the specific needs of your course. Our programme consists of in-person, on-campus teaching, enabling full engagement with your lecturers and fellow students.

We believe in fostering a learning environment where students actively engage with physics concepts through experimentation, data analysis, and problem-solving. We offer informal weekly Maths drop-in support sessions to assist with developing and enhancing problem solving skills. These are mentored by postgraduate students.

We use inquiry-based learning, labs and practical work and diverse assessment types throughout the programme. The labs and practical work promote active engagement, hands-on learning, diverse skills development and real-world experience. The research project modules gives you the opportunity to participate in real-life research, working on real-world problems/questions. Lectures take place in larger group sessions, in a lecture theatre setting. The course content is explored in further detail in workshops, allowing for further collaborative working with your peers.

Lecture recordings allow for more flexibility to revisit material, to revise for assessments and to enhance learning outside of the classroom. Some modules have extra resources in Canvas, our virtual learning environment, such as videos, slides and quizzes enabling further flexible study.

BSc Theoretical Physics with a year in industry

On our Physics year in industry programme you will enhance your career-prospects combining classroom based learning with a year long industrial placement of your choice. Utilising your analytical and critical mindset you will focus your third year in an industrial placement, combining all your skills in a working environment. You will graduate with much more than a degree, you will gain real hands on experience and work with real industry professionals in a real working environment.
